2001–02 Highland Football League

The 2001–02 Highland Football League was won by Fraserburgh. Rothes finished bottom. Inverurie Loco Works joined the Highland League this season, increasing the number of teams from 14 to 15.

Table

Pos Team Pld W D L GF GA GD Pts
1 Fraserburgh (C) 28 20 4 4 71 36 +35 64
2 Deveronvale 28 19 4 5 68 27 +41 61
3 Buckie Thistle 28 15 8 5 51 27 +24 53
4 Clachnacuddin 28 13 10 5 60 39 +21 49
5 Keith 28 14 5 9 57 37 +20 47
6 Cove Rangers 28 12 7 9 72 60 +12 43
7 Inverurie Loco Works 28 12 4 12 48 43 +5 40
8 Brora Rangers 28 12 4 12 47 55 8 40
9 Huntly 28 11 6 11 46 36 +10 39
10 Forres Mechanics 28 9 10 9 49 46 +3 37
11 Lossiemouth 28 9 6 13 23 40 17 33
12 Nairn County 28 6 8 14 45 61 16 26
13 Fort William 28 7 2 19 30 62 32 23
14 Wick Academy 28 5 4 19 20 59 39 19
15 Rothes 28 2 6 20 24 83 59 12
Source: Scottish Football Historical Archive - Highland League Final Tables
Rules for classification: 1) points; 2) goal difference; 3) number of goals scored.
(C) Champion.
